Origin and history

Saint-Benoît Church, also known as San-Benedettu, is a religious monument located in the municipality of Alata, Corsica. The available data do not specify its construction period or detailed historical context, thus limiting the understanding of its architectural or spiritual evolution. In the Corsican region, local churches have often played a central role in community life, serving as places of worship, gathering and identity.

These buildings generally reflect the religious and cultural traditions of the surrounding populations, while being part of a landscape marked by a rich and complex history.
